Volunteers Stay Busy Over the Weekend

The Honey Brook Fire Company remained busy over the weekend, responding to five calls for service:

At 03:54 Friday morning, Engine 33-1 and Chief 33 responded to a Fire Alarm at the Tel Hai Complex. Upon investigation, a burnt-up hydraulic pump causing a light smoke condition was discovered in the basement.

At 11:12 Saturday morning, Station 33 along with Lancaster Truck 39 responded to a reported chimney fire on the 600 block of Churchtown Rd. Crews investigated, mitigated hazards, and cleared a short time later. At 13:24 that afternoon, Engine 33-1 and Chief 33 responded to a fire alarm on the 3100 block of Horseshoe Pike.

At 09:53 Sunday Morning, Engine 33-1 and Assistant 33 handled an appliance fire on the 3600 block of Horseshoe Pike. Engine 33-1 arrived and stretched an 1-3/4" line to the front door. Inside, crews found a blower motor and electrical components burning underneath a propane stove. Crews mitigated hazards, secured utilities, and cleared the scene in under an hour. Later that evening at 21:07, Rescue 33 along with Assistant 33 handled a medical emergency in the borough assisting Micu-193.
